⚠️ Severe Weather Alert – April 2nd ⚠️
Carlisle School District is closely monitoring the forecasted severe weather for Wednesday, April 2nd.
Our district has conducted multiple safety drills throughout the year to prepare for situations like this.
Please note:
• If severe weather occurs and warnings are issued at dismissal, buses will not depart, and staff will not load cars until conditions improve.
• In the event of an active tornado threat, staff will shelter in place with students. Parents/guardians will not be allowed to check out students until it is safe to do so.
• Any bus delays or weather-related updates will be shared immediately via social media, text, and call-outs.
